摘要:

Studies have been made of the electrophoretic behavior of various samples of plutonia and thoria. Significant differences were observed between samples of the same compound having a different history, but general common trends were apparent. Differences in behavior between plutonia and thoria were no greater than those between different samples of either compound.Adsorption isotherms were calculated using a standard model of the double layer. The data suggest that both plutonia and thoria surfaces adsorb multivalent cations much more readily than monovalent ones. Anions are adsorbed to a varying degree, with the notable exception of nitrate. Both hydrogen and hydroxyl ions significantly affect the surface charge density. The adsorption isotherms do not obey a simple Langmuir law.
